Transaction 9842926684f005f6de808e0176bb3b4af8838d94a6072399644d03da2c0a828d
1 Input
1 Output
-
9842926684f005f6de808e0176bb3b4af8838d94a6072399644d03da2c0a828d:0
- value
- 23349
- script pubkey
- OP_0 OP_PUSHBYTES_20 f8a3a2c2eac001131b2d04885d059def18fd18a1
- address
- bc1qlz369sh2cqq3xxedqjy96pvaauv06x9pds0l5c